Lithuanian half-grosz, Sigismund I the Old (King of Poland; 1506–1548). Obverse: Pogon (Lithuanian coat of arms) turned left; rim between pearly borders with inscription '+ MONETA:SIG, VNDI:1514'. Reverse: crowned Polish eagle; rim between pearly borders with inscription 'GNI:DVCIS:LITVANI, 1514'. Polish coins; Jagiellon dynasty; Grand Duchy of Lithuania; Vilnius; coin.
